Tunable protein crystal size distribution via continuous slug-flow crystallization with spatially varying temperature
<jats:p>Under appropriate buffer and pH conditions, the magnitude and dispersion of the product protein crystals were reproducibly manipulated by controlling the spatial temperature along the tube in a continuous tubular crystallizer.</jats:p>
